# Break-Glass Access — Thumbcache Leak

Welcome aboard! If the image cache in Fernwick's Thumbcache service starts leaking memory again (it balloons past 6 GB, usually after a burst of oversized uploads), you may need break-glass access to restart it directly, since normal deploy perms take a day to provision. Don't feel bad about using it — that's what it's for, just log it in the incident channel. To unseal the break-glass credentials bundle, use the recovery passphrase below.

vault phrase of tajop-haduf = holath-brivan-wenax

## Step 4: Configure Rate Limiting

Plugins calling the Brimway gateway are rate-limited per key. Set `RL_BUCKET_SIZE=100` and `RL_REFILL_PER_SEC=10` in your plugin's env. Exceeding limits returns 429 with a `Retry-After` header — honor it or your key gets throttled harder. Burst mode needs `RL_BURST_ENABLED=true` and gateway-team signoff. Limits are enforced at the edge, so local testing against the sandbox tier is mandatory. Your plugin's gateway shared secret goes on the line immediately below.

sealed setting: ARCHIVE_KEY3=8d0

## Who to ping about GiftNote

Welcome aboard! GiftNote is our donation-receipt mailer for the Larchfield Fund. Template tweaks go to the comms folks; delivery failures and bounce weirdness go to the platform crew. Don't push template changes on Fridays — receipts batch over the weekend. For anything GiftNote-related, start with the address below.

billing contact of kaweg-tajeg = drudor.lamion.oliath@torvalabs.test

## Deploying the Gatewick Proctor Queue

Deploys are pretty painless: push to main, wait for the pipeline, then watch the queue drain dashboard for five minutes. If candidates pile up mid-exam, roll back first and ask questions later — the queue replays safely. Everything the workers care about lives in one config block, shown here for reference.

settings of bafof-yagef:
JOROX_PIN=8740
JOROX_TENANT=pelox
JOROX_METRICS_HOST=metrics.jorox.qorvelworks.internal
JOROX_SEAL=seal_c78f63c1
JOROX_STANDBY_TEAM=norax